What We Do
West Coast Drawing is here to show that drawing, in all its diversity, is an end, not just a means, as valid an art form as oil on canvas, fresco on walls, carved marble, or contemporary quirks. In this group, some of San Diego's best artists working in drawing media come together for mutual inspiration and exhibition and to raise the bar for drawing. They define drawing as any two-dimensional expression that goes on dry or with a stick.
We have recently upgraded our name from the San Diego Drawing Group to West Coast Drawing to reflect our ambitions and the stellar reputations of the members. Members meet about once a month to plan exhibitions, to share experiences, and to hear speakers who enhance their artistic lives. They nurture and support each other in their art careers, and have a lot of fun doing it. Membership standards are high. Only a third of applicants has been accepted. Maximum membership will be 25.
The group was founded in 2003. Each member of West Coast Drawing conducts a productive professional art career apart from the activities in this organization. Their work ranges from photorealism, to total abstraction, to expressionism.
